Book Book MHERC Communication & Relationships 362.196/85833 (Browse shelf(Opens below)) Available It may be cybersex, but it can feel like real infidelity to your partner, says authors Mark Chamberlain and Geoff Steurer. There's nothing virtual about the damage pornography does to a relationship. The good news is that the marriage itself can be a couple's most powerful tool in healing in a pornography habit. This helpful, informative, and insightful book will help couples learn how to harness that strength to make their marriages more fulfilling than they ever imagined possible. A41294299
